Sorry, it was mitsubishiparts.com not .net. Look under the online catalog, put in the 2003-2006 Lancer evo. go to fender, structual components and rails, engine bracket, right side only and it should be part number 13 that you need.

Ok small update so i finally finnished honeymooning and received the camgears,evo 8 steering wheel and the 5 spd shifter box yesterday.the stock steering wheel was taken out and trashed the evo 8 wheel was a peice of cake to install just need the airbag for it now car already feels faster lol also the automatic shifter was taken out and replaced with a 5 spd shifter box from a evo 9 evrything bolted right up thank God
also installed the camgears today just need the coilpacks and i'll have a complete head.




Automatic shfter out and never to return lol


Where the automatic shifetr was mounted and where the manual shifter will be mounted all the bolts line up perfect




The automatic console is reusable but i will be changing it when i am ready to order my carpet and other interior panels
